Cap polyposis of the colon: A report of 2 cases with unique clinical presentations but similar histopathologic findings
Cap polyposis is a rare, non-neoplastic disease characterized by multiple inflammatory polyps that are covered by a "cap" of fibrinopurulent granulation tissue and in most cases are located between the distal colon and the rectum. Patients usually present with bloody diarrhea, mucoid stool...
